SINGER ANASTACIA SPEAKS FOR THE FIRST TIME ABOUT HER MARRIAGE TO HER MINDER – AND REVEALS WHY SHE LIED ABOUT HER AGE FOR 10 YEARS

By Chrissy Iley
Feisty singer Anastacia didn’t think she needed a man.

She certainly didn’t need a cocky beefcake of a bodyguard bossing her around.

But the friction between the singer and her minder Wayne Newton quickly turned to the crackle of sexual chemistry.

“I’d be saying to myself: ‘What are you even thinking? This is your bodyguard!’” Anastacia tells us.

They had worked together since 2004 and it certainly wasn’t love at first sight.

“I didn’t even like him,” she says.

“I was going to sack him because I thought he was far too cocky for me.

"He’s worked with Madonna, Mariah – all the divas.”

So did the relationship creep up on her?

“No, it was more a slap in the face,” she explains.

“I’d never thought about Wayne romantically. For a start, he was working for me. That’s a no-no.

"And, in the beginning, he was in a relationship with the mother of his boys, who are now 12 and five.”

They eventually got together and just six months later, Wayne proposed.

“It was coming up to my birthday in September last year and he was acting a bit weird,” she muses.

“Then he said: ‘Can I have a dollar?’ I went to look in my purse and there was a little box in it.

"I unwrapped it and it was a beautiful ring. He looked at me and said: ‘Will you get married to me?’

They got married on a Mexican beach in April last year.

With his tall, muscular physique, Wayne, 41, is the perfect guardian angel for 5ft 3in Anastacia.

And because of him she is now happy to be herself, which is partly why she is telling the truth about her age for the first time in 10 years.

“I’m turning 40,” she confesses. “And I’m happy to tell Fabulous because I’ve always lied about my age.”

And the fib had a huge impact when Anastacia was diagnosed with breast cancer in 2003.

Although she was 35, her fans thought she was 31, making the story of her illness even more shocking.

“At that point I thought I really didn’t care that it was a lie,” she says, “because people thought that being young meant you didn’t get cancer, but there were tons of young women who wrote to me and had cancer.

"I felt I needed to be the voice for that.”

After beating the disease, Anastacia tried to correct her age.

“I would just say I was in my 30s.

"But that became embarrassing because people would wonder what I was hiding. I’m thrilled I can finally be 40.”

She freed herself from the lie after signing a new record deal and unveiling a softer look to promote her fifth album, Heavy Rotation.

Anastacia, who turns 40 on September 17, may be embracing the truth, but she isn’t so keen to welcome the ageing process.

“I’m a believer in saying: ‘If you want to get maintenance, get it,’” she says.

“If Botox and fillers make you feel better, just make sure you go to a good doctor.”

And it looks like she practises what she preaches.

“I got Botox six months ago,” she explains.

“And I had a laser peel to get rid of freckles on my face as I think they make you look older.”

Anastacia has had many personal battles to focus her mind away from love.

As well as beating breast cancer, she’s battled Crohn’s disease – a chronic bowel disorder – since she was 13.

When I tell her that she’s a superwoman, she adds: “I’ve also been diagnosed with a heart condition – supraventricular tachycardia.

"I was having palpitations.

"They told me I could take a pill or have an operation. I said: ‘Enough operations for me, I’ll take the pill.’”

She says marriage has changed her.

She’s moved from her native America to Richmond, Surrey, and relishes being looked after.

“Marriage has a great effect on everything,” she reflects.

“Wayne really does look after me. He’s an unbelievable father.

"It makes me even more in love with him, seeing how great he is as a dad.”

Does this mean she is broody for her own children?

“No. I love children, and at different parts of my life I have wanted to have a child, but now my life is full,’ she says.

“In fact, when we married, that was the deal for both of us.

"Wayne would have given me a child but I said: ‘You can ask me in any language but the answer would be no.’”

Will she change her mind?

“No, I’m a deliberate kind of chick,” she laughs.

So would anything make her life even more blissful?

“To be honest I really feel like I have it all. In my world right now I’ve got everything as perfect as it can be.

"I don’t want to ruin the recipe.”

Anastacia’s new album is released October 27, featuring the single I Can Feel You.
